The area of a rectangular swimming pool is 10x2 – 19x – 15. The length of the pool is 5x + 3. What is the width of the pool? (1 point) Responses 2x – 18 2 x – 18 2x – 5 2 x – 5 5x – 5 5 x – 5 5x – 22

To find the width of the pool, you need to divide the area by the length.

Area = 10x^2 – 19x – 15
Length = 5x + 3

Width = Area / Length
Width = (10x^2 – 19x – 15) / (5x + 3)
Width = (5x + 3)(2x - 5) / (5x + 3)
Width = 2x - 5

Therefore, the width of the pool is 2x - 5.
